Donuts That Don’t Make Your Ass Fat


holey_donuts.jpg

iVillage sent me an email today telling me about donuts that are Holey Donuts,“zero trans fats,very low total fat (only 3 to 4 grams of total fat per donut vs. 20 grams of fat in other donuts!)”. Isn’t that an oxymoron? How is that possible? People must have been curious because Holy Donut’s website was down the rest of the afternoon.

Holey claims that …

  • There is no greasy aftertaste
  • They don’t add artificial sweeteners or fat substitutes
  • Their cooking process avoids deep frying so they are light and fluffy

They sound horrible! But people are claiming they taste just as good as the fatty ones. I think this passionate donut eater says it best.

To order a dozen of these delectable treats they are a whopping $23.95 which is pricey. But here is the kicker… to ship them to Florida it was an extra $17.80! Damn. But it appears that is the only way you can treat yourself. I guess I will wait until Starbucks carries them.
